Subject: [PATCH] [OpenCL] Fix extensions checks for 3.1
These extension checks apply to 3.1 as well.
This fix kernel build fails when OpenCL 3.1 is enabled in
https://github.com/intel/opencl-clang/pull/752
Assisted-by: Claude
---
clang/include/clang/Basic/OpenCLOptions.h | 2 +-
clang/lib/Sema/SemaOpenCL.cpp | 2 +-
clang/lib/Sema/SemaType.cpp | 4 +--
clang/test/SemaOpenCL/access-qualifier.cl | 12 +++++----
clang/test/SemaOpenCL/fp64-fp16-options.cl | 7 +++++
clang/test/SemaOpenCL/storageclass.cl | 30 ++++++++++++----------
clang/test/SemaOpenCL/unsupported-image.cl | 3 +++
7 files changed, 38 insertions(+), 22 deletions(-)
diff --git a/clang/include/clang/Basic/OpenCLOptions.h b/clang/include/clang/Basic/OpenCLOptions.h
index ec661bba94adb..915aad94cc5b0 100644
--- a/clang/include/clang/Basic/OpenCLOptions.h
+++ b/clang/include/clang/Basic/OpenCLOptions.h
@@ -83,7 +83,7 @@ class OpenCLOptions {
// C++ for OpenCL inherits rule from OpenCL C v2.0.
bool areProgramScopeVariablesSupported(const LangOptions &Opts) const {
return Opts.getOpenCLCompatibleVersion() == 200 ||
- (Opts.getOpenCLCompatibleVersion() == 300 &&
+ (Opts.getOpenCLCompatibleVersion() >= 300 &&
isSupported("__opencl_c_program_scope_global_variables", Opts));
}
diff --git a/clang/lib/Sema/SemaOpenCL.cpp b/clang/lib/Sema/SemaOpenCL.cpp
index 4151972c67473..4cc7bf451ea1d 100644
--- a/clang/lib/Sema/SemaOpenCL.cpp
+++ b/clang/lib/Sema/SemaOpenCL.cpp
@@ -63,7 +63,7 @@ void SemaOpenCL::handleAccessAttr(Decl *D, const ParsedAttr &AL) {
if (AL.getAttrName()->getName().contains("read_write")) {
bool ReadWriteImagesUnsupported =
(getLangOpts().getOpenCLCompatibleVersion() < 200) ||
- (getLangOpts().getOpenCLCompatibleVersion() == 300 &&
+ (getLangOpts().getOpenCLCompatibleVersion() >= 300 &&
!SemaRef.getOpenCLOptions().isSupported(
"__opencl_c_read_write_images", getLangOpts()));
if (ReadWriteImagesUnsupported || DeclTy->isPipeType()) {
diff --git a/clang/lib/Sema/SemaType.cpp b/clang/lib/Sema/SemaType.cpp
index 1378c7baca92e..3f0a7304db2f9 100644
--- a/clang/lib/Sema/SemaType.cpp
+++ b/clang/lib/Sema/SemaType.cpp
@@ -1182,7 +1182,7 @@ static QualType ConvertDeclSpecToType(TypeProcessingState &state) {
if (!S.getOpenCLOptions().isSupported("cl_khr_fp64", S.getLangOpts()))
S.Diag(DS.getTypeSpecTypeLoc(), diag::err_opencl_requires_extension)
<< 0 << Result
- << (S.getLangOpts().getOpenCLCompatibleVersion() == 300
+ << (S.getLangOpts().getOpenCLCompatibleVersion() >= 300
? "cl_khr_fp64 and __opencl_c_fp64"
: "cl_khr_fp64");
else if (!S.getOpenCLOptions().isAvailableOption("cl_khr_fp64", S.getLangOpts()))
@@ -1407,7 +1407,7 @@ static QualType ConvertDeclSpecToType(TypeProcessingState &state) {
if (S.getLangOpts().OpenCL) {
const auto &OpenCLOptions = S.getOpenCLOptions();
bool IsOpenCLC30Compatible =
- S.getLangOpts().getOpenCLCompatibleVersion() == 300;
+ S.getLangOpts().getOpenCLCompatibleVersion() >= 300;
// OpenCL C v3.0 s6.3.3 - OpenCL image types require __opencl_c_images
// support.
// OpenCL C v3.0 s6.2.1 - OpenCL 3d image write types requires support
